Austin Bergstrom Airport Centre Ltd. is the seller. Airport Fast Park-Austin LP is the official buyer. The Kucera Co. in Austin has handled the transaction.

The project will accommodate parking overflow and will aid airport development plans that call for a doubling of the facilities in the coming years. That expansion includes the cargo area, which neighbors the land buy.

Air cargo is up 39% from last year, with 357 tons of cargo shipped. And, the growth is continuing at a hardy pace this year. The master plan calls for cargo space to double to 400,000 sf. The Lynx Group of Austin and Aeroterm have developed the existing 200,000.
